NSN: 5935-00-402-7419

Connectors, Electrical

CONNECTOR,PLUG,ELECTRICAL

5935 - Connectors, Electrical

CONNECTOR,PLUG,ELECTRICAL

Technical Characteristics

  • Test Data Document

    81349-mil-c-5015 specification

  • Thread Class

    2b

  • Body Length

    5.062 inches nominal

  • Overall Diameter

    1.625 inches nominal

  • Threaded Device Type

    coupling facility

  • Mating End Quantity

    1

  • Contact Removability

    nonremovable

  • Contact Maximum Current Rating In Amps

    22.0

  • Contact Maximum Dc Voltage Rating In Volts

    700.0

  • Polarization Method

    keyway or multiple keyway

  • Insert Position In Deg

    0.0

  • Shell Type

    solid

  • Connector Locking Method

    internally threaded coupling ring

  • Insert Material

    plastic phenolic mineral filled

  • Shell Material

    aluminum alloy

  • Included Contact Quantity

    14

  • Included Contact Type

    round socket

  • Thread Direction

    right-hand

  • Furnished Items

    wire rope

  • Environmental Protection

    watertight

  • Cable Entrance Diameter

    0.688 inches minimum and 0.750 inches maximum

  • Contact Maximum Ac Voltage Rating In Volts

    500.0

  • Connector Cable Strain Relief Method

    compression nut

  • Nominal Thread Size

    1.375 inches

  • Terminal Location

    back

  • Contact Surface Treatment

    silver

  • Terminal Type

    crimp

  • Shell Surface Treatment

    anodize

  • Thread Series Designator

    unef
